1981 Fiat Campagnola vs. 2005 Honda Mobilio

To start off, 2005 Honda Mobilio is newer by 24 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Fiat Campagnola.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Fiat Campagnola would be higher. At 1,994 cc (4 cylinders), 1981 Fiat Campagnola is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Honda Mobilio (108 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 29 more horse power than 1981 Fiat Campagnola. (79 HP @ 4600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Honda Mobilio should accelerate faster than 1981 Fiat Campagnola.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1981 Fiat Campagnola weights approximately 350 kg more than 2005 Honda Mobilio.

Let's talk about torque, 1981 Fiat Campagnola (151 Nm @ 2800 RPM) has 8 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Honda Mobilio. (143 Nm @ 4800 RPM). This means 1981 Fiat Campagnola will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Honda Mobilio.
